What Is City of Rochester Michigan?

The City of Rochester, settled in 1817, is a full service community offering residents, visitors and businesses the highest quality municipal services. Rochester services include a full service local Police Department; Fire and EMS service, offering both basic and advanced life support transportation services; curbside trash removal and recycling; fully developed and natural setting parks; miles of passive recreation trailways; multi-purpose ball fields; a full-service Department of Public Works, including street sweeping and curbside leaf removal; election services; pet licensing; public water and sewer services; code compliance office; and full-service building inspections. Why Rochester - CNN/Money Magazine recognized Rochester's excellent quality of life in 2009 by naming it as one of the Top 100 Best Places to Live. - Rochester was also featured by U.S. News and World Report’s “The Best Life” serious by Philip Moeller as being one of the “10 Best Places for Lifelong Learning.” - Rochester is just minutes from Oakland University,Rochester College, and Oakland Community College. There are over 26 other major colleges and universities in southeastern Michigan. - The City of Rochester features a historic, vibrant, and thriving downtown which has been recognized as one of the best in the State of Michigan and nationally. - Honored by ICMA in 2010 with a “Voice of the People Award of Excellence” for have the highest service ratings for its citizens. - 2017 marked the 200th Anniversary since Rochester was settled, and 50 years since Rochester was incorporated as a City.
